Definition
Chronic headache or orofacial pain associated with disorders of homeostasis or their nonpharmacological treatment is caused by disorders of homoeostasis or the nonpharmacological treatment thereof, and has a duration of more than three months. The pain occurs on at least 50% of the days during at least three months. The duration of pain per day is at least 2 hours. Relevant disorders of homeostasis include hypoxia and/or hypercapnia (i.e. high altitude, aeroplane travel, diving, and sleep apnea), dialysis, arterial hypertension, hypothyroidism, fasting, and cardiac cephalalgia. Relevant nonpharmacological treatments of disorders of homeostasis that can cause chronic headache or orofacial pain include dialysis and therapeutic hypocapnia. Diagnostic Criteria Conditions A to D are fulfilled: A. Headache or orofacial pain for >2 hours on ≥15 days per month for longer than 3 months. B. Disorder of homoeostasis or its nonpharmacological treatment scientifically documented to be able to cause headache or orofacial pain has been documented. C. Evidence of causation demonstrated by at least two of the following: C.1 Headache or orofacial pain has developed in temporal relation to the disorders of homoeostasis or their nonpharmacological treatment. C.2 One or both of the following is fulfilled: a) Headache or orofacial pain has significantly worsened in parallel with worsening of the disorders of homoeostasis or their nonpharmacological treatment. b) Headache or orofacial pain has significantly improved in parallel with improvement of the disorders of homoeostasis or their nonpharmacological treatment. C.3. Headache or orofacial pain has characteristics typical for the disorders of homoeostasis or their nonpharmacological treatment. C.4. Other evidence of causation exists D. The pain is not better accounted for by another diagnosis. [No translation available]
